Effect of high glucose on the expression of liver X receptors and ABCA1 in human THP-1 macrophages / 中华肾脏病杂志

ABSTRACT
Objective To investigate the effect of high glucose on the expression of liver X receptors (LXRs) and ATP-binding cassette transporter A1 (ABCA1) in human macrophages (THP-1 cell line). Methods THP-1 monocytes were differentiated into macrophages by induction of phorbol 12, 13-dibutyrate (PMA). Surface markers of macrophages were identified by CD68 immunohistochemistry. The macrophages were cultured with different concentration (5.6, 11.1, 22.2 and 33.3 mmol/L) of glucose and different time (0, 0.5, 2, 6, 12, 24, 48, 72 h). Real time PCR and Western blotting methods were used to examine the mRNA and protein expression of LXRs and ABCA1. Results As compared to 5.6 mmol/L glucose, macrophage LXRβ and ABCA1 were decreased significantly at both mRNA and protein levels in dose-and time-dependent manner (P<0.05). Conclusion Hyperglycemia may play a role in the pathogenesis of arteriosclerosis through the inhibition of LXRs and ABCA1 expression in diabetic patients.
